Vibe Coding: building your e-commerce site with AI without a developer
Summary
In January 2025, Andrej Karpathy (co-founder of OpenAI) published the term « Vibe Coding » on X. In 60 days, the concept generated more than 200,000 mentions. Startup founders describe MVPs built over weekends. E-retailers create their own automation tools. The line between “I know how to code” and “I don’t know how to code” has just moved.
What exactly is Vibe Coding?
Vibe Coding consists of piloting a generative AI tool (Claude, GPT-4, Gemini) via an augmented code editor (Cursor, Windsurf) or a no-code/AI platform (Bolt.new, Lovable) by describing in natural language what you want to build. The AI generates the code, you test, you correct via new instructions.
The principle: you are the project manager, the AI is the developer. You describe the expected behavior (« when the user clicks on this button, display a popup with the contact form »), the AI writes the corresponding code. You don’t need to read the code — only test the result and fix any deviations.
This is not no-code in the classic sense (Webflow, Shopify sections). It’s an intermediate level: you touch the code, but you don’t write it. For e-retailers who want to go further, our offer Vibe Coding e-commerce includes structured support from design to deployment.
What tools should I use to do Vibe Coding in e-commerce?
The Vibe Coding tools market is structured into two categories: augmented editors (for those who can open a code file) and AI builders (for those who want to stay in a visual interface).
AI-augmented code editors
- Cursor: fork of VS Code with Claude and GPT integrated. Ideal for modifying existing Shopify, WooCommerce or PrestaShop themes. Understanding the context of the entire project.
- Windsurf (Codeium): similar to Cursor, with a slightly more accessible interface for beginners.
- Claude Code (Anthropic): powerful CLI tool for technical projects, with reasoning ability on complex codebases.
AI Builders (without code editor)
- Bolt.new: Generates complete React/Node applications from a description. One-click deployment via Netlify. Perfect for internal tools or complex landing pages.
- Lovable: focused on SaaS applications and user interfaces. Generates clean, maintainable React code.
- v0 (Vercel): specialized in the generation of UI components. Excellent for creating tailor-made sections of e-commerce pages.
For most e-retailers, the most effective combination is Cursor + Claude for theme changes and integrations, and Bolt.new for tools or pages to create from scratch. Our page Vibe Coding e-commerce details the stacks according to your CMS.
What can you actually build without knowing how to code?
The relevant question is not « can we do everything » but « what is reasonably feasible in Vibe Coding on an e-commerce without technical training ». Here’s what works well in practice:
- Landing pages and campaign pages: tailor-made HTML/CSS structure, animations, personalized sections — outside the CMS template
- Simple API integrations: connect a form to a CRM (HubSpot, Brevo), send data to a Google Sheet, trigger a webhook
- Personalization scripts: display a promotional banner according to location, modify the price displayed according to the customer segment
- Internal tools: product description generator, price calculation tool, simplified monitoring dashboard
- Theme modifications: add a field, modify the layout of a product sheet, create a personalized page template
A concrete example: a Shopify e-retailer created a product configurator in 4 hours of Vibe Coding (selection of variants with visual preview) which would have cost €3,000 to €5,000 for a freelance developer. The generated code was functional and deployed directly to production.
What are the real limits of Vibe Coding?
Vibe Coding does not replace everything. Some situations require technical expertise that AI alone cannot compensate for:
- Security and Payments: Everything related to transactions, customer data and authentications requires review by an experienced developer. AI generates functional code but not necessarily secure.
- Large-scale performance: an e-commerce application with 100,000 orders/day has architectural constraints that Vibe Coding cannot resolve alone.
- Debugging complex errors: When the bug comes from an interaction between multiple systems, the AI often goes in circles without a deep understanding of the architecture.
- Migrations and database redesign: destructive operations on real data are not subjects for unsupervised Vibe Coding.
The practical rule: Vibe Coding works on well-defined problems with a clear scope. The wider and more interconnected the scope, the greater the risk of hallucinations and unmaintainable code.
Why does support radically change the result?
The difference between an e-retailer who « try Vibe Coding » and one who derives a real competitive advantage from it is the prompt structure and architectural vision. AI is excellent at carrying out a precise instruction. It is poor at defining what to build and in what order.
Vibe Coding support for e-commerce consists of: defining development priorities, structuring prompts to avoid deviations, validating the code generated before deployment and training the team to maintain the elements created. Our Vibe Coding offer covers exactly this scope — from the roadmap to production. By combining Vibe Coding with a semantic cocoons architecture, some clients multiply their production of optimized content by 5 in a few weeks.
FAQ — Vibe Coding e-commerce
What is Vibe Coding?
Vibe Coding is a development method where we describe in natural language what we want to build to an AI (Claude, GPT-4), which generates the corresponding code. The user controls the result without writing any code themselves. The term was popularized by Andrej Karpathy (co-founder of OpenAI) in January 2025.
Can you really create an e-commerce site without knowing how to code?
Yes, for well-defined elements: landing pages, campaign pages, simple API integrations, personalization scripts, internal tools. Complex functionalities (secure payment, large-scale inventory management, multi-country architecture) still require human technical expertise for supervision and validation.
Which tools should I use for e-commerce Vibe Coding?
For existing theme modifications (Shopify, WooCommerce): Cursor or Windsurf with Claude. To create tools or pages from scratch: Bolt.new or Lovable. For isolated UI components: v0 from Vercel. The Cursor + Claude combination is the most versatile for an e-retailer who wants to modify their existing site.
Does Vibe Coding replace a developer?
No. It significantly reduces the need for developers for well-defined and repetitive tasks. But for security, large-scale performance, data migrations, and complex debugging, an experienced developer is still essential. Vibe Coding is a productivity tool, not a replacement.
What budget for Vibe Coding e-commerce support?
Vibe Coding support for e-commerce varies depending on the scope: from €1,500 for an intensive training session with production of a specific tool, to €5,000–8,000 for complete support over 6 to 8 weeks including roadmap, assisted development and team training. Visit our dedicated page for details.